heaps of movement in North Queensland
The Cowboys have traditionally used 3 feeder teams to spread their talent, in Cairns, Townsville and Mackay. Last year they decided they wanted more direct control, and just used the Townsville Blackhawks as their reserve grade side. This proved too much disruption, and the Blackhawks had a poor year.
So they went nuclear and have declared their allegiance is now to the Rabbitohs. Meaning the Cowboys now do not have a Q-Cup presence in Townsville. Presumably they will come crawling back to the Pride and Cutters asking them to take back their players. Bizarre situation all round
